Abstract
The invention discloses a kind of guide rail illuminators, comprising: a track, the track is interior to be equipped with insulation strip, and the insulation strip is equipped with multiple card slots, and which is provided with multiple Power Supply Assemblies;An at least lamps and lanterns, the lamps and lanterns are connect by a conducting wire with Power Supply Assembly;An at least mobile device, each lamps and lanterns are set on the track by a mobile device, the mobile device includes a bracket for being used for support lamps and lanterns, the frame bottom is connect with lamps and lanterns, its top is located in the track, and the cradle top is equipped with lock pin component, the lock pin component includes a telescopic pin, and described telescopic pin one end is arranged on a card slot.Compared with prior art, lamps and lanterns can be moved freely on the track that it is laid with by manually adjusting by track installation in the multiple lamps and lanterns for needing illumination region, and being arranged on track in the present invention.A kind of lighting system with the guide rail illuminator is also disclosed simultaneously.

Specific embodiment
To make those skilled in the art that the object, technical solutions and advantages of the present invention be more clearly understood, with
Under the present invention is further elaborated in conjunction with the accompanying drawings and embodiments.
Referring to Figure 1 to Figure 7, Fig. 1 to Fig. 7 illustrates the first embodiment of guide rail illuminator 201 of the present invention.In attached drawing institute
In the embodiment shown, the guide rail illuminator 201 includes a track 10, at least a lamps and lanterns 20 and an at least mobile device
30, each lamps and lanterns 20 are set on the track 10 by a mobile device 30, wherein are equipped with insulation in the track 10
Item 50, the insulation strip 50 is equipped with multiple card slots 501, and which is provided with multiple Power Supply Assemblies;The lamps and lanterns 20 are led by one
Line 201 is connect with Power Supply Assembly;The mobile device 30 includes a bracket 301 for being used for support lamps and lanterns 20,301 bottom of bracket
Portion is connect with lamps and lanterns 20, and top is located in the track 10, and lock pin component 302, the lock pin are equipped at the top of the bracket 301
Component 302 includes a telescopic pin 3021, and described 3021 one end of telescopic pin is arranged on a card slot 501.Based on above-mentioned design,
Lamps and lanterns 20 are installed on the multiple lamps and lanterns 20 for needing illumination region, and being arranged on track 10 by track 10 and can be laid at it in the present invention
Track 10 on moved freely by manually adjusting, i.e. the present invention is located at by 301 support lamps and lanterns 20 of bracket at the top of bracket 301
In track 10, and the telescopic pin 3021 being arranged thereon and card slot 501 cooperate and lamps and lanterns 20 are installed on track 10, when needing to move
When the position of dynamic lamps and lanterns 20, it is only necessary to pull downward on telescopic pin 3021 so that telescopic pin 3021 is detached from card slot 501, i.e. movable light
The drawbacks of having 20, avoiding fixedly mounted illuminator 20 does not have to arrange too many lamps and lanterns 20 in big region, can according to need
Dispersion or centralized lighting realize the multi-purpose purpose of a lamp, and the lamps and lanterns 20 for facilitating replacement to damage.
In certain embodiments, the lock pin component 302 further includes a pull ring 3022, the pull ring 3022 and telescopic pin
3021 connections when pulling downward on pull ring 3022 to make telescopic pin 3021 be detached from card slot 501, and the pull ring 3022 and telescopic pin
A reset spring 3023 is equipped between 3021, so that telescopic pin 3021 is arranged in again on the card slot 501.Specifically, reference
Fig. 6, the pull ring 3022 include a connecting rod 3221 and the annulus 3222 extended to form from 3221 one end of connecting rod, the connecting rod
3221 other ends wear the bracket 301 and are connected to the telescopic pin 3021, which stretches out on the bracket 301
Surface and be arranged on card slot 501, the reset spring 3023 is sheathed on the connecting rod 3221, and one end is connected to telescopic pin
3021, the other end is connected on 301 bottom plate of bracket.Based on the design, annulus 3222 is pulled downward on, telescopic pin 3021 is in pulling force
It is moved down under effect, the reset spring 3023 for being detached from card slot 501, and being set on connecting rod 3221 compresses, when unclamping annulus 3222, i.e.,
When no longer to 3222 applied force of annulus, telescopic pin 3021 is arranged in card slot 501 again under the action of reset spring 3023.
With continued reference to Fig. 5, in certain embodiments, 50 lower surface of insulation strip is equipped with multiple slot groups, each slot group packet
Two grooves 502 being set side by side are included, each Power Supply Assembly is set in a slot group, wherein each Power Supply Assembly includes that an anode is led
It is recessed that electric body 601 and a negative electrode conductor 602, i.e., each cathode conductor 601 and negative electrode conductor 602 are respectively arranged on arranged side by side one
In slot 502.Based on the design, cathode conductor 601 and negative electrode conductor 602 are located in groove 502, and surface is lower than groove
502 surfaces can avoid the risk that user's finger is accidentally got an electric shock.
Further, in this embodiment the bracket 301 is bent downward including a cross bar 3011, from 3011 both ends of cross bar
Two connecting rods 3012 formed and two vertical bars 3013 being downwardly extending respectively from one end of two connecting rods 3012, described two
Vertical bar 3013 is fixedly connected with 20 side of lamps and lanterns respectively, and the cross bar 3011 is located in the track 10,3011 both ends of cross bar
It is arranged with one first box body 3014 and the second box body 3015 respectively, the lock pin component 302 is set in first box body 3014,
And telescopic pin 3021 is stretched out 3014 upper surface of the first box body and is arranged on card slot 501, the annulus of the pull ring 3022
3222 stretch out 3014 lower surfaces of the first box body, second box body 3015 be equipped with respectively with cathode conductor 601 and negative
Two resilient contacts 3016 that pole electric conductor 602 connects, the conducting wire 201 are connect with two resilient contacts 3016.Based on above-mentioned design,
Resilient contact 3016 on the bracket 301 be convenient for on guide rail cathode conductor 601 and negative electrode conductor 602 connect, and
And when the movement of lamps and lanterns 20, the cathode conductor 601 and negative electrode conductor 602 being laid with always with 50 lower surface of insulation strip are contacted,
Wiring can be reduced, wiring is simple.
In the embodiment shown in the figures, the track 10 includes rectangular housing 101, and the rectangular housing 101 is hollow
Structure, which is equipped with one first notch 102, and upwardly extends from the bottom plate both ends and be formed with two first
Rectangular slab 103, two first rectangular slabs, 103 top are connected with one second rectangular slab 104, upwards from 104 top of the second rectangular slab
The two third rectangular slabs 106 being set side by side are extended to form, and 101 top plate of the rectangular housing offers one second notch 105,
The insulation strip 50 is located in the space that first rectangular slab 103 and the second rectangular slab 104 are formed.It is tight by one referring to Fig. 7
Guide rail illuminator 201 is lifted on wall 2 by firmware 70, suitable for installing lighting apparatus after finishing, it will be appreciated that ground, it can also be with
Track 10 is mounted in wall 2.
Understandably, the resilient contact 3016 when initial, in the guide rail illuminator 201 in the present embodiment on bracket 301
It is connected to the cathode conductor 601 and negative electrode conductor 602 of the laying of 10 interior insulation item of track, 50 lower surface, when user needs to move
When the position of lamps and lanterns 20, the rope that can be sheathed on annulus 3222 by one pulls downward on pull ring 3022, to drive telescopic pin
3021 move down, and are detached from card slot 501, and reset spring 3023 compresses at this time, and user can pull bracket 301 in track 10 by rope
It is mobile, to drive lamps and lanterns 20 mobile, the rope being sheathed on annulus 3222 is unclamped when lamps and lanterns 20 reach designated position, is resetted
Spring 3023 discharges, and telescopic pin 3021 is arranged in card slot 501 again under the thrust of reset spring 3023.
It is the schematic perspective view of 201 second embodiment of guide rail illuminator of the present invention referring to Fig. 8, Fig. 8.In attached drawing institute
In the embodiment shown, the present embodiment and first embodiment are the difference is that embodiment adds a driving mechanisms.
In the present embodiment, the driving mechanism includes a motor 401, mounting rack 402, runner 403, cam 404 and control
Device processed, the mounting rack 402 is set to 302 side of lock pin component, and is fixed on 301 connecting rod 3012 of bracket and vertical bar
On one end of 3013 connections, the motor shaft of the motor 401 wears 402 side of mounting rack and connect with runner 403, the runner
403 include a shaft 4031 and multiple fan blades 4032, which passes through fan blade 4032 and card slot under the driving of motor 401
501 cooperation and drive lamps and lanterns 20 mobile, the motor 401 is connect with cam 404 with controller, and the installation of the cam 404
It is connect in 402 other side of mounting rack, and by a connecting line 405 with the annulus 3222 in lock pin component 302, so that stretching
Contracting pin 3021 is detached from card slot 501.In the present embodiment, the controller can control the motor 401 and cam 404 based on PLC
Running, and in some other embodiments, which may be based on the control chip such as ARM, DSP to realize.Understandably,
Other structures and function in the present embodiment are identical with the first embodiment, and details are not described herein, and the guide rail in the present embodiment
Illuminator 201 can pass through the work of a remote control control driving mechanism.It is real by the driving mechanism of installation based on above-mentioned design
The movement for having showed automatic intelligent control lamps and lanterns 20 is sent by remote controler and is controlled that is, when needing the position of movable lamps 20
Signal to controller, controller drives cam 404 to work, and the cam 404 is rotated such that connection cam 404 and annulus 3222
Connecting line 405 be wound in the shaft of cam 404, so that a pulling force is provided to annulus 3222, so that telescopic pin 3021 is de-
From card slot 501, controller driving motor 401 works at this time, to drive runner 403 to rotate, by 403 shaft 4031 of runner
The cooperation of card slot 501 on the multiple fan blades 4032 and insulation strip 50 being arranged, so that runner 403 and 50 relative motion of insulation strip, with
Bracket 301 is driven to move, so that lamps and lanterns 20 be driven to move, when lamps and lanterns 20 move to predetermined position, then controller sends signal
To motor 401 and cam 404, so that motor 401 stops working, while cam 404 resets, and telescopic pin 3021 is in reset spring
It is arranged in card slot 501 again under the action of 3023.
